The light of day is a 2003 novel by english author graham swift, published seven years after his previous novel, the booker prize winner last orders. The aim of the seeing the light of day project, funded through the arts council englands museum resilience fund, was to develop sustainable solutions for the management, accessibility and longterm preservation of archaeological archives.
